In mid-May, OpenAI announced that an internal AI model had disproved the ErdĆs unit distance conjecture, a famous problem in discrete geometry that had stumped human mathematicians for the last 80 years.
OpenAI gave several mathematicians early access to the result and published their reactions.
Tim Gowersâwho won the Fields Medal, the most prestigious prize in mathematicsâwrote that âthere is no doubt that the solution to the unit-distance problem is a milestone in AI mathematics.â University of Toronto professor Daniel Litt wrote that âthis is the first example of a result produced autonomously by an AI that I find exciting in itself, as opposed to as a leading indicator.â Itâs arguably the first time that an AI system has found a proof resolving a major open conjecture.
Thatâs impressive, but I donât view it as a radical break from the previous trajectory of AI progress in mathematics.
